Lettuce That Is Cold And Heat Tolerant. In this guide, we’ll explore how to grow the best heat tolerant lettuce, share tips to keep your greens thriving even in hot weather, and introduce you to varieties specially bred to handle the heat. There are varieties within each family that are more heat resistant than others. The lettuce family is composed of butterhead lettuce, leaf lettuce, oakleaf lettuce, and romaine lettuce. In the warmest regions, try growing these leafy greens. While lettuce is known for bolting in the heat, leading to bitter salads, this doesn’t have to be the case.
